Remove the crusts from the bread slices.
2
Slice bread into 1/2-inch pieces (does not have to be exact, you should have about 12-14 cups cubes).
3
Spread the bread cubes on a large baking sheet.
4
Bake at 350 degrees for about 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ally and rotating the sheet/s halfway through baking time until the cubes are lightly toasted; place in a large bowl.
5
Melt butter in a large skillet over medium heat until HOT and sizzling.
6
Add in onions, garlic and celery (with the chopped leaves) stir immediately with wooden spoon; add in the poultry seasoning, seasoned salt and black pepper; saute for about 5-6 minutes.
7
Stir the onion/celery mixture along with the chopped water chestnuts into the bread cubes; toss well to combine.
8
Add in more seasoned salt (or white salt) and black pepper if desired to taste.
9
Let the stuffing cool completely before stuffing the turkey or roasting chicken.
